Enrolment Process
01
Submit an Online Enrolment
Thank you for your interest in Oxford Falls Grammar. It is recommended you submit an enrolment application form as soon as possible. Applications for entry to all school years are to be made on the online enrolment form by clicking the APPLY NOW button below. Please read and understand our schedule of fees and enrolment policies before submitting an application.
02
Provide Updated Information
Stage 2 of the enrolment process is the collection of recent information about your child or children such as recent school reports or NAPLAN results. The Registrar will be in contact to retrieve this information, 2 years prior to your child’s Year 7 enrolment and 1 year prior to the enrolment of all other years.
Please contact our Registrar Mrs Kim Rooke with any questions Registrar@ofg.nsw.edu.au.
03
Accept an Offer
The school will be in contact if and when a position becomes available. Both parents and child will meet with either the Registrar, Head of Senior School or Junior School before a placement is confirmed. All enrolment applicants will sit an entrance test to cater for each child’s academic ability.
Once an interview has been conducted, successful enrolment applicants will receive an Offer of Enrolment. If you choose to accept our offer, a non-refundable enrolment fee and a refundable bond is paid (refer to schedule of fees for current bond amounts). Your child’s enrolment at Oxford Falls Grammar is then confirmed.

The New OFG Uniform
The new OFG uniform was introduced in Term 1, 2021. Our new uniform reunites OFG navy and red and introduces an accent colour of sand. These three colours are integrated stylishly across our academic, PE and competitive sports uniforms, providing a consistent and contemporary image for OFG students.
The academic uniform has been reimagined across all year levels from Kindergarten through to Year 12 with subtle changes to signify our students’ educational journey. Shorts and pants have been introduced as uniform options for girls across all year groups.
Our new PE uniform features the latest performance based fabric, offering our students comfort and flexibility from Years 3 – 12.
Kindergarten – Year 2
Play based uniform has been introduced and worn for both academic and sporting purposes.
Years 3 – 6
Summer and winter uniforms are supplemented with shorts and pants options for both boys and girls. A navy blazer has been introduced for warmth during the colder months in Term 2 and 3. This style of blazer is worn by all students right through to Year 12.
Years 7 – 10
Summer and winter uniforms are supplemented with shorts and pants options for both boys and girls. A navy and red striped summer dress has been introduced for girls.
Years 11 – 12
Our senior students wear the same academic uniform all year round with options for shorts and pants and short and long sleeved shirts for summer and winter. The navy blazer is embroidered with red and sand piping to signify seniority within the school.
There will be a two year transition period and the new uniform will be compulsory from Term 1, 2023.
